给定关系模式 R;其中 U 为属性集,F 是 U 上的一组函数依赖,那么 Armstroog 公理系统的增广律是指( )。A.若 X→Y,X→Z,则 X→YZ 为 F 所蕴涵B.若 X→Y,WY→Z,则 XW→Z 为 F 所蕴涵C.若 X→Y,Y→Z 为 F 所蕴涵,则 X→Z 为 F 所蕴涵D.若 X→Y,为 F 所蕴涵,且 Z?U,则入 XZ→YZ 为 F 所蕴涵
给定关系模式 R;其中 U 为属性集,F 是 U 上的一组函数依赖,那么 Armstroog 公理系统的增广律是指( )。
A.若 X→Y,X→Z,则 X→YZ 为 F 所蕴涵
B.若 X→Y,WY→Z,则 XW→Z 为 F 所蕴涵
C.若 X→Y,Y→Z 为 F 所蕴涵,则 X→Z 为 F 所蕴涵
D.若 X→Y,为 F 所蕴涵,且 Z?U,则入 XZ→YZ 为 F 所蕴涵
B.若 X→Y,WY→Z,则 XW→Z 为 F 所蕴涵
C.若 X→Y,Y→Z 为 F 所蕴涵,则 X→Z 为 F 所蕴涵
D.若 X→Y,为 F 所蕴涵,且 Z?U,则入 XZ→YZ 为 F 所蕴涵
参考解析
解析:从已知的一些函数依赖,可以推导出另外一些函数依赖,这就需要一系列推理规则。函数依赖的推理规则最早出现在1974年W.W.Armstrong 的论文里,这些规则常被称作"Armstrong 公理"设U 是关系模式R 的属性集,F 是R 上成立的只涉及U 中属性的函数依赖集。函数依赖的推理规则有以下三条:自反律:若属性集Y 包含于属性集X,属性集X 包含于U,则X→Y 在R 上成立。(此处X→Y是平凡函数依赖)增广律:若X→Y 在R 上成立,且属性集Z 包含于属性集U,则XZ→YZ 在R 上成立。传递律:若X→Y 和 Y→Z在R 上成立,则X →Z 在R 上成立。其他的所有函数依赖的推理规则可以使用这三条规则推导出。
根据上面三条规律,又可推出下面三条推理规则:④ 合并规则:若X→Y,X→Z,则X→YZ为F所蕴含;⑤ 伪传递规则:若X→Y,WY→Z,则XW→Z为F所蕴含;⑥ 分解规则:若X→Y,Z?Y,则X→Z为F所蕴含。引理:X→A1A2…Ak成立的充分必要条件是X→Ai成立(i=1,2,...,k)。
本题题目是考“增广律”,学员需务必看清楚题目的提问项(很容易被混淆),因此答案为D。
根据上面三条规律,又可推出下面三条推理规则:④ 合并规则:若X→Y,X→Z,则X→YZ为F所蕴含;⑤ 伪传递规则:若X→Y,WY→Z,则XW→Z为F所蕴含;⑥ 分解规则:若X→Y,Z?Y,则X→Z为F所蕴含。引理:X→A1A2…Ak成立的充分必要条件是X→Ai成立(i=1,2,...,k)。
本题题目是考“增广律”,学员需务必看清楚题目的提问项(很容易被混淆),因此答案为D。
相关考题:
(17)Armstrong 公理系统中的增广律的含义是:设 R 是一个关系模式,X,Y 是U 中属性组,若 X→Y 为 F所逻辑蕴含,且 ZíU,则___________为 F 所逻辑蕴含。
Armstrong公理系统中的增广律的含义是:设R,是一个关系模式,X,Y是U中属性组,若x→Y为F所逻辑 Armstrong公理系统中的增广律的含义是:设R<U,F>,是一个关系模式,X,Y是U中属性组,若x→Y为F所逻辑蕴含,且Z∈U,则【 】为F所逻辑蕴含。
令关系模式R=S(U;F),其中U为属性集,F为函数依赖集。假设U=X、Y、Z为3个不可分解的不同属性,若F={XY→Z,YZ→X),则R保持依赖的关系模式分解,一般只能分解到______。A.1NFB.2NFC.3NFD.BCNFA.B.C.D.
根据关系模型中数据间的函数依赖关系,关系模式可分成多种不同的范式(NP),其中,第二范式排除了关系模式中非主属性对键的(16)函数依赖;第三范式排除了关系式中非主属性对键的(17)函数依赖。令关系模式R=S(U;F),其中U为属性集,F为函数依赖集,假设U=XYZ为三个不可分解的不同属性,那么若F;{X→Y,Y→Z},则R是(18)。若F ={XY→Z,YZ→X),则R保持依赖的关系模式分解,一般只能分解到(19)。A.传递B.非传递C.完全D.部分
给定关系模式R(U,F),其中U为关系R属性集,F是U上的一组函数依赖,若 X→Y,(42)是错误的,因为该函数依赖不蕴涵在F中。A.Y→Z成立,则X→ZB.X→Z成立,则X→YZC.ZU成立,则X→YZD.WY→Z成立,则XW→Z
设关系模式R,其中U为属性集,F是U上的一组函数依赖,那么Armstrong公理系统的伪传递律是指()。 设关系模式R<U,F>,其中U为属性集,F是U上的一组函数依赖,那么Armstrong公理系统的伪传递律是指()。A.若X→Y,Y→Z为F所蕴涵,则X→Z为F所蕴涵B.若X→Y,X→Z,则X→YZ为F所蕴涵C.若X→Y,WY→Z,则XW→Z为F所蕴涵D.若X→Y为F所蕴涵,且Z?U,则XZ→YZ为F所蕴涵
给定关系模式R(U,F),萁中:u为关系模式R中的属性集,,是u上的一组函数依赖。假设u={A1,A2,A3;A4),F={A1→A2,A1A2→A3,A1→A4,A2→A4那么关系R的主键应为( 52 )。函数依赖集F中的( 53 )是冗余的。A.AI →A2B.AIA2→A3C.Al→A4D.A2→A4
设关系模式R (U,F),其中U为属性集, F是U上的一组函数依赖,那么函数依赖的公理系统(Armstrong公理系统)中的合并规则是指为( )为F所蕴涵。A.若AB,BC,则ACB.若YXU,则XY。C.若AB,AC ,则ABCD.若AB,CB,则AC
设关系模式R(U,F),其中R上的属性集U={A,B,C,D,E},R上的函数依赖集 F={A→B,DE→B,CB→E,E→A,B→D}。(1)为关系R的候选关键字。分解(2)是无损连接,并保持函数依赖的。(1)A.ABB.DEC.CED.DB
● 给定关系模式 ( ) F U R , ,其中U 为关系R属性集,F 是U 上的一组函数依赖,若 Y X → , (42) 是错误的,因为该函数依赖不蕴涵在F中。(42)A. Z Y → 成立,则 Z X →B. Z X → 成立,则 YZ X →C. U Z ? 成立,则 YZ X →D. Z WY → 成立,则 Z XW →
给定关系模式 R;其中 U 为属性集,F 是 U 上的一组函数依赖,那么 Armstroog 公理系统的增广律是指( )。A.若 X→Y,X→Z,则 X→YZ 为 F 所蕴涵B.若 X→Y,WY→Z,则 XW→Z 为 F 所蕴涵C.若 X→Y,Y→Z 为 F 所蕴涵,则 X→Z 为 F 所蕴涵D.若 X→Y,为 F 所蕴涵,且 Z?U,则入 XZ→YZ 为 F 所蕴涵
给定关系模式R(U,F.,其中:属性集U={A,B,C,D,E,G},函数依赖集F={A→B,A→C,C→D,AE→G}。因为(请作答此空)=U,且满足最小性,所以其为R的候选码;关系模式R属于( ),因为它存在非主属性对码的部分函数依赖;若将R分解为如下两个关系模式( ),则分解后的关系模式保持函数依赖。
设关系模式R<U,F>,其中U为属性集,F是U上的一组函数依赖,那么Armstrong公理系统的伪传递律是指( )。A.若X→Y,Y→Z为F所蕴涵,则X→Z为F所蕴涵B.若X→Y,X→Z,则X→YZ为F所蕴涵C.若X→Y,WY→Z,则XW→Z为F所蕴涵D.若X→Y为F所蕴涵,且Z?U,则XZ→YZ为F所蕴涵
给定关系模式R,其中属性集U={A,B,C,D,E,G,H}函数依赖集F={A→B,AE→H,BG→DC,E→C,H→E},下列函数依赖不成立的是( )A.A→ABB.H→CC.AEB→CD.A→BH
给定关系模式R(U,F.,其中:属性集U={A,B,C,D,E,G},函数依赖集F={A→B,A→C,C→D,AE→G}。因为( )=U,且满足最小性,所以其为R的候选码;关系模式R属于(请作答此空),因为它存在非主属性对码的部分函数依赖;若将R分解为如下两个关系模式( ),则分解后的关系模式保持函数依赖。A.1NFB.2NFC.3NFD.BCNF
设关系模式R (U,F),其中U为属性集, F是U上的一组函数依赖,那么函数依赖的公理系统 (Armstrong公理系统)中的合并规则是指为( )为F所蕴涵。 A. 若A→B,B→C,则A→CB. 若Y?X?U,则X→YC. 若A→B,B→C ,则A→BCD. 若A→B,C?B,则A-+C
给定关系模式 R;其中 U 为属性集,F 是 U 上的一组函数依赖,那么 Armstroog 公理系统的增广律是指( )。A.若 X→Y,X→Z,则 X→YZ 为 F 所蕴涵B.若 X→Y,WY→Z,则 XW→Z 为 F 所蕴涵C.若 X→Y,Y→Z 为 F 所蕴涵,则 X→Z 为 F 所蕴涵D.若 X→Y,为 F 所蕴涵,且 ZU,则入 XZ→YZ 为 F 所蕴涵
给定关系模式R,其中U为属性集,F是U上的一组函数依赖,那么Armstrong公理系统的伪传递律是指( )。A.若X→Y,X→Z,则X→YZ为F所蕴涵B.若X→Y,WY→Z,则XW→Z为F所蕴涵C.若X→Y,Y→Z为F所蕴涵,则X→Z为F所蕴涵D.若Ⅹ→Y为F所蕴涵,且Z U,则XZ→YZ为F所蕴涵
给定关系模式R(U,F),其中:U为关系模式R中的属性集,F是U上的一组函数依赖。假设U={A1,A2,A3,A4},F={A1→A2,A1A2→A3,A1→A4,A2→A4},那么关系R的主键应为( )A.A1B.A1A2C.A1A3D.A1A2A3
给定关系模式R(U,F),其中:U为关系模式R中的属性集,F是U上的一组函数依赖。假设U={A1,A2,A3,A4},F={A1→A2,A1A2→A3,A1→A4,A2→A4},函数依赖集F中的( )是冗余的。A.A1→A2B.A1A2→A3C.A1→A4D.A2→A4
给定关系模式R;其中U为属性集,F是U上的一组函数依赖,那么Armstroog公理系统的传递律是指( )。A.若X→Y,X→Z,则X→YZ为F所蕴涵B.若X→Y,WY→Z,则XW→Z为F所蕴涵C.若X→Y,Y→Z为F所蕴涵,则X→Z为F所蕴涵D.若X→Y,为F所蕴涵,且ZU,则入XZ→YZ为F所蕴涵
设关系模式R(U,F),其中R上的属性集U={A,B,C,D,E},R上的函数依赖集 F={A→B,DE→B,CB→E,E→A,B→D}。 (请作答此空)为关系R的候选关键字。分解( )是无损连接,并保持函数依赖的。 A.AB B.DE C.CE D.DB
给定关系模式 R(U,F),其中: 属性集 U={A1 ,A2,A3,A4,A5,A6}, 函数依赖集F={A1→A2, A1→A3, A3→A4, A1A5→A6}。关系模式 R 的候选码为( ),由于 R 存在非主属性对码的部分函数依赖,所以 R 属于_(请作答此空)_.A.1NFB.2NFC.3NFD.BCNF
设关系模式R(U,F),其中R上的属性集U={A,B,C,D,E},R上的函数依赖集F={A→B,DE→B,CB→E,E→A,B→D}。()为关系R的候选关键字。 A. ABB. DEC. CED. DB
单选题设关系模式R(U,F),其中,R上的属性集U={A,B,C,D,E},R上的函数依赖集F=(A→B,DE→B,CB→E,E→A,B→D}。(1)为关系R的候选关键字。分解(2)是无损联接,并保持函数依赖的。空白(1)处应选择()AABBDECCEDCD